I need to rewrite two expressions in terms of exponentials and simplify.

First expression: 2cosh(ln x) –> Answer should be x + 1/x

Second expression: ln(cosh x + sinh x) + ln(cosh x – sinh x) –> Do not know answer

A step by step would be helpful, I really need to learn this and am sinking at the moment. Thank you in advance.

Best Answer

This might help, (by definition):

$$\cosh x = \frac{e^x + e^{-x}}{2}$$

Replace x with $\ln x$ and simplify, note that $e^{\ln x} = x$

Use a similar idea for your second expression and note that:

$$ \sinh x = \frac{e^x - e^{-x}}{2}$$
